Etymology[edit]

pellet +‎ -y

Adjective[edit]

pellety (comparative more pellety, superlative most pellety)

  1. Having a consistency like pellets.
  2. Full of pellets.
    • 1963, George MacBeth, Owl:
      Round beaks are at / work in the pellety nest, / working. Owl is an eye / in the barn.
  3. (heraldry, not comparable) Semé (strewn) with pellets (roundels sable).
    • 1933, James Thomas Herbert Baily, The Connoisseur:
      : -gules, a hind trippant or between three pheons or, within a bordure engrailed argent pellety. The printed version of Glover , which is frequently incorrect and is, incidentally, responsible for the use of many false []
    • 1998, Joan Corder, John Blatchly, A Dictionary of Suffolk Crests: Heraldic Crests of Suffolk Families, Boydell & Brewer, →ISBN, page 319:
      A dragon's head erased Or pellety eared and langued Gules.
